Driver Killed In Early Morning I-680 Crash In Sunol
Updated: A Walnut Creek man, 20, was ejected from his car and died at the hospital.
SUNOL, CA — A Walnut Creek man died early Thursday after his car rolled over on I-680.
The driver, 20, was not wearing a seat belt and was ejected from his Toyota during the crash, according to the Dublin chapter of the California Highway Patrol. The crash was reported just before 4:30 a.m. on southbound Interstate 680 north of Koopman Road in Sunol.
The driver was hospitalized at Eden Medical Center, where he succumbed to his injuries, CHP said.

No other cars were involved.
At least one lane was blocked as CHP responded.

The driver's name has not been released as officials work to notify his family. The investigation is ongoing.
